What I Looked for Before Buying
Before I made a decision, I paid attention to a few important things:
- Screen size compatibility: I made sure the protector matched my TV’s exact size.
- Material quality: I preferred durable materials like acrylic or tempered options.
- Clarity: I wanted a protector that would not reduce brightness or color quality.
- Anti-glare feature: This helped me reduce reflections in a bright room.
- Easy installation: I wanted something I could install without professional help.
Types of Screen Protectors I Found
I came across a few different types while shopping:
- Acrylic protectors: Lightweight and clear, good for basic protection.
- Tempered glass protectors: Stronger and more resistant to impact.
- Anti-glare protectors: Helpful if my TV is placed near windows or lights.
- Dust and scratch guards: Best for keeping the screen clean and safe from minor damage.
My Thoughts on Size and Fit
One thing I learned quickly was that size matters a lot. I measured my TV carefully before ordering because even a small mismatch can cause problems. I also checked the bezel design and mounting style to make sure the protector would sit properly on the screen.
Why Clarity Matters to Me
I did not want to buy a protector that would make my TV picture look dull or blurry. For me, a good screen protector should be nearly invisible once installed. High transparency and minimal distortion were very important because I still wanted to enjoy sharp visuals and rich colors.
Installation Experience I Prefer
I personally like products that come with clear instructions and all the necessary mounting accessories. A good screen protector should be easy to attach, remove, and clean. I also looked for models that did not leave marks or damage the TV frame.
Budget vs. Quality
I found that the cheapest option is not always the best. I was willing to spend a little more for better durability and clearer viewing. In my experience, a balanced option that offers both protection and good picture quality is usually the smartest choice.
